[Ajuda] /esalvar
#1

Galera estou com um Poblema nesse comando
Apos eu digita-lo o (Samp-Server) Fecha sozinho,e tenho que abrir novamente !
Queria saber qual e o poblema nele,e como arruma-lo !
Код:
	    if( !strcmp( cmd, "/esalvar", true ))
		{
			tmp = strtok( cmdtext, idx );
			if( !strlen( tmp ))
			{
			    SendClientMessage( playerid, COLOR_ERRO, "[ x ] Uso correto: /eSalvar [ Nome ]" );
				return 1;
			}
  			new
				nomeEvento[ 256 ]
			;
			nomeEvento = tmp;
		   	salvarRace( playerid, nomeEvento );
			return 1;
		}
Reply
#2

Quote:
Originally Posted by leonardoaparecido
Посмотреть сообщение
Galera estou com um Poblema nesse comando
Apos eu digita-lo o (Samp-Server) Fecha sozinho,e tenho que abrir novamente !
Queria saber qual e o poblema nele,e como arruma-lo !
Код:
	    if( !strcmp( cmd, "/esalvar", true ))
		{
			tmp = strtok( cmdtext, idx );
			if( !strlen( tmp ))
			{
			    SendClientMessage( playerid, COLOR_ERRO, "[ x ] Uso correto: /eSalvar [ Nome ]" );
				return 1;
			}
  			new
				nomeEvento[ 256 ]
			;
			nomeEvento = tmp;
		   	salvarRace( playerid, nomeEvento );
			return 1;
		}

Talvez voce nao tem a pasta na Scriptfiles fazendo que isso feche o Samp-Server Verefique o diretorio da pasta q vai salvar a corrida talvez seja isso !
Reply
#3

Ja verifiquei e tem sim :S
O nome dela e
eSalvos
Reply
#4

Sla vie o Comando n encontrei nada de errado No Codigo !
Reply
#5

pawn Код:
if(!strcmp("esalvar", cmdtext[1], true)) {

    if(!cmdtext[8])
        return SendClientMessage(playerid, -1, "Uso: /esalvar [nome]");

    salvarRace(playerid, cmdtext[8]);
    return 1;
}
Veja se funciona desta maneira.
Reply
#6

Funciono nao zPain
A Hr que digito /esalvar [Nome] Aparece comando invalido !
Ashei esse codigo acima do /esalvar
Код:
	 	if( !strcmp( cmd, "/eload", true ))
		{
			new
				length = strlen( cmdtext )
			;
			while(( idx < length ) && ( cmdtext[ idx ] <= ' ' ))
			{
				idx ++;
			}
			new
				offset = idx
			;
			new
				result[ 64 ]
			;
			while(( idx < length ) && (( idx - offset ) < ( sizeof( result ) - 1 )) )
			{
				result[ idx - offset ] = cmdtext[ idx ];
				idx ++;
			}
			result[ idx - offset ] = EOS;
			if( !strlen( result ))
			{
				SendClientMessage( playerid, COLOR_ERRO, "[ x ] Uso correto: /eCarregar [ Nome ]" );
				return 1;
			}
	 		new
			 	nomeEvento[ 24 ], nomeEventov[ 24 ]
		 	;
			format( nomeEvento, sizeof( nomeEvento ), "eSalvos/CPS/%s.txt", result );
			format( nomeEventov, sizeof( nomeEventov ), "eSalvos/VS/%s.txt", result );
			carregarRace( playerid, nomeEvento );
			carregarVeiculos( nomeEventov );
			return 1;
		}
Reply
#7

pawn Код:
if( !strcmp( cmd, "/esalvar", true ))
{
    new length = strlen( cmdtext );
    while(( idx < length ) && ( cmdtext[ idx ] <= ' ' ))
    {
        idx ++;
    }
    new offset = idx;
    new result[ 64 ];
    while(( idx < length ) && (( idx - offset ) < ( sizeof( result ) - 1 )) )
    {
        result[ idx - offset ] = cmdtext[ idx ];
        idx ++;
    }
    result[ idx - offset ] = EOS;
    if( !strlen( result ))
    {
        SendClientMessage( playerid, COLOR_ERRO, "[ x ] Uso correto: /eCarregar [ Nome ]" );
        return 1;
    }
    salvarRace(playerid, result);
    return 1;
}
Tentemos desta maneira, entгo.
Reply
#8

Ok e o code do /esalvar fica o antigo ou oque voce mandou ?
Reply
#9

Perdгo, nгo altere o comando /eload. O comando que postei acima й o /esalvar. Jб corrigi.
Reply
#10

Fechou novamente o ( samp-server )
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)